Perfect for families This 2020 Dufour 390 is an excellent choice if you're bringing a group of up to eight people—the three-cabin layout works well for multi-family charters or friends traveling together. She's built by a trusted European builder known for comfort and reliability, so you're getting proven quality.
Smart practical features The solar panels, autopilot, and chart plotter mean less faffing about and more time enjoying yourself, while the bimini and sprayhood keep everyone comfortable in variable conditions. These aren't luxury add-ons; they're the genuinely useful kit that makes a charter less stressful.
Good value equation At 11.9 meters with three cabins and the 2020 build year, the pricing sits in the sensible mid-range for this class—you're not paying premium rates for a newer boat that's already proven itself. The €2,000 deposit is reasonable and suggests transparent terms.
One fair note Sightsea Yachting's five-star rating comes from only three reviews, so while that's encouraging, it's a smaller sample than you might find with larger operators—worth doing your own diligence on their support and communication before committing, especially if you're flying in from overseas.
